Success of electrocardioversion on the elderly

Rhythm control for elderly atrial fibrillation (AF) patients showed a 51.3% recurrence rate within one year. This suggests rhythm control is a viable strategy for persistent AF in this population.

Background:
- Medication-resistant atrial fibrillation (AF) presents two management options: rhythm or rate control.
- Rate control is considered safe in well-tolerated AF due to no increased mortality.
- The efficacy of rhythm control in elderly AF patients requires further investigation.
Purpose of the Study:
- To evaluate the 1-year outcome of rhythm control therapy in elderly patients with atrial fibrillation.
- To identify predictors of AF recurrence after rhythm control intervention in this demographic.
Main Methods:
- Retrospective analysis of data from electrocardioversions (ECV) and outpatient follow-up visits.
- Inclusion of 436 consecutive elderly patients undergoing ECV between February 2008 and November 2011.
- Assessment of AF recurrence within the first year post-ECV and identification of predictive factors.
Main Results:
- The 1-year recurrence rate of atrial fibrillation following ECV was 51.3%.
- Female sex and enlarged left atrial diameter were identified as independent predictors of AF recurrence.
- The observed recurrence rate in the elderly cohort was comparable to that in younger populations.
Conclusions:
- Rhythm control demonstrates a comparable AF recurrence rate in elderly patients to younger individuals.
- Rhythm control is a viable therapeutic strategy for managing persistent atrial fibrillation in the elderly.
- Female gender and increased left atrial size are significant predictors for AF recurrence in older adults.
